CARTER, Justice.
By his complaint for a declaratory judgment, the plaintiff, Bruce Blackmer, sought to establish in himself and in the general public a prescriptive easement over the property of the defendant Wendall Williams. The plaintiff also sought damages from the defendant on a claim for assault and battery. Williams counter-claimed alleging an assault by the plaintiff.
